Survival Strategies: How Ladybugs Make it Through the Winter

Ladybugs have evolved remarkable survival strategies to endure harsh winter conditions. One of their most impressive techniques is diapause, a state of dormancy that allows them to conserve energy and survive for extended periods without food. During diapause, ladybugs enter a state of torpor, reducing their metabolic rate and slowing down their heartbeats. This enables them to withstand extreme temperatures, lack of food, and other environmental stressors. Predators and Prey: The Complex World of Ladybug Ecology

Ladybugs have several natural predators, including birds, spiders, and other insects. These predators play a vital role in maintaining the balance of ecosystems, ensuring that no single species dominates the environment. Ladybugs, in turn, have evolved various defense mechanisms to protect themselves from predators. They can release a foul-tasting fluid to deter predators, or they can adopt a ‘play dead’ strategy to avoid detection. The Diverse World of Ladybugs: Species and Characteristics

There are over 6,000 known species of ladybugs, ranging in size, color, and behavior. Some species, such as the seven-spotted ladybug, are common and widespread, while others are rare and endemic to specific regions. Ladybugs can be identified by their distinctive markings, shape, and size, making them a fascinating group to study and explore.
